The Hue slider changes the shade of your selected colour, Saturation adjusts the intensity, while Luminance determines how light or dark the colour is. If you accidentally painted over an undesired area, hold the ‘Alt’ key on a PC or the ‘Option’ key on a Mac to turn the Adjustment Brush into an Erase brush.
